Recognized as World Heritage site by UNESCO, peaceful Hoian ancient town is one of the most popular destinations in Vietnam satisfying travellers of all tastes and across the continents.
Located in Central Vietnam, Danang has many strengths and tourism potential to develop thanks for its geographical location, average temperatures, history, economy and culture. In Vietnam’s tourism development plan, Danang, Quang Nam and Hue are three priority poles.
Renowned as the most royal city in Vietnam, Hue has enough charm to keep you staying as long as you can afford the time to visit
Thuy Bieu is an ancient village featured by its rustic settings, typical of Hue countryside.
Phuoc Tich Village with very little change over hundreds of years is a popular destination in Hue.
Nature has offered Quang Binh a superb world natural heritage - Phong Nha-Ke Bang National Park - unique in terms of geology, topography, biodiversity and geomorphology. The park contains 300 caves and Phong Nha is considered one of the finest in the world.
The rich diversity of fauna and flora resulted Cham Island to grow based on ecotourism to protect natural beauty.
My Son is a unique beautiful sanctuary world of the ancient Chăm religion day by day attracting thousands of tourists elsewhere!
Well-known for charming mountainous landscape, Quang Binh is now attracting more tourists both domestic and overseas
